Output 77e1582a3945643b10309232bb53c66924c532cb8a97516f5b920e2e4250910a:0

value
101000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c479ae3648650caacd816205b488692f0a96d5 OP_EQUAL
address
37WBryQFoTZCxwLg1V2hFraEAh5piSBtzN
transaction
77e1582a3945643b10309232bb53c66924c532cb8a97516f5b920e2e4250910a
confirmations
322299
spent
true